Changing a reference to one used earlier

In my Word document, I have a reference #4 and then several pages later, reference #16. Both referred to different citations.

I need to delete reference #16 and replace it with reference #4 at that location.

This will require all of the subsequent references to be updated (reference #17 should now become #16, etc).

Highlighting reference #6 in the document, selecting Add/Edit Citation, then deleting and adding reference #4 does not change the numbering. It remains #16 resulting in the same reference being listed in the bibliography at the #4 and # 16 spot.

The remaining reference numbers also do not change.

I've tried refreshing numerous times. I'ive also tried physically deleting reference #16 from my Zotero library and refreshing the Word document. The citation number #16 remains in the Word document. Physically deleting it within the Zotero Add/Edit function or within the Word document still does not result in the subsequent reference numbers updating.

  • Check if you have "Automatically updated references" enabled in the Document Preferences? If not, try with in enabled.
  • Interesting.

    "Automatically updated references" was enabled. So, I turned it off; added in my reference #4; refreshed, then deleted #16 (all within the Zotero Word add in).

    It worked. Old reference #16 was gone. Reference #4 was cited it in its place, and the subsequent references renumbered correctly.
